Partager via


Fonction SetGuide (recapis.h)

Définit le guide de reconnaissance à utiliser pour les entrées en boîte ou en ligne. Vous devez appeler cette fonction avant d’ajouter des traits au contexte.

Syntaxe

HRESULT SetGuide(
  HRECOCONTEXT     hrc,
  const RECO_GUIDE *pGuide,
  ULONG            iIndex
);

Paramètres

hrc

Gérez le contexte du module de reconnaissance.

pGuide

Guide à utiliser pour l’entrée de zone ou de ligne. La définition de ce paramètre sur NULL signifie que le contexte n’a pas de repère. Il s’agit de la valeur par défaut et signifie que le module de reconnaissance est en mode entrée libre. Pour plus d’informations sur le guide, consultez la structure RECO_GUIDE .

iIndex

Valeur d’index à utiliser pour la première zone ou ligne du contexte.

Valeur retournée

Cette fonction peut retourner l’une de ces valeurs.

Code de retour Description
S_OK
Réussite.
E_POINTER
Le contexte n’est pas valide ou l’un des paramètres est un pointeur non valide.
E_OUTOFMEMORY
Impossible d’allouer de la mémoire pour terminer l’opération.
E_INVALIDARG
Tentative de définition d’un mode de reconnaissance (libre, aligné, encadré, etc.) qui n’est pas pris en charge par le module de reconnaissance, ou les valeurs de champ RECO_GUIDE sont illégales (hauteurs ou largeurs négatives, par exemple).
E_FAIL
Une erreur non spécifiée s'est produite.
TPC_E_OUT_OF_ORDER_CALL
Tentative de définition du repère lorsqu’il y avait déjà un peu d’encre dans le contexte de reco, ou, dans le cas des reconnaissances de caractères d’Asie de l’Est, SetCACMode a été appelé précédemment.

Remarques

Les zones de repère sont numérotées en fonction de la valeur iIntex .

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ows XP Édition Tablet PC [applications de bureau | Applications UWP]
Serveur minimal pris en charge Aucun pris en charge
Plateforme cible Windows
En-tête recapis.h
DLL inkobjcore.dll

Voir aussi

GetGuide, fonction

RECO_GUIDE Structure